Job Summary

Provides evaluation of and care for respiratory therapy patients. Administers prescribed respiratory therapeutic services.

Job Responsibilities and Requirements Primary Responsibilities
  • Assesses patient for appropriate type and frequency of treatment and develops a plan of care based on diagnosis.
  • Responsible for providing respiratory care services in accordance with specific physician's orders, department policies and procedures and guidelines.
  • Implements and monitors patient care plan and equipment. Monitors, records and communicates patient condition. Performs advanced respiratory care modalities.
  • Evaluates respiratory practice, administration of medications, and treatment based on patient outcome.
  • Educates the patient and family about the health condition and provides information about community support groups and other available programs.
  • Assists with care, calibration and maintenance of all equipment. Participates in maintaining departmental inventory levels for supplies and equipment. Processes equipment per established cleaning/sterilization procedures.
  • Responds to Medical Emergencies and Rapid Responses.
  • Works in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Required Professional License And/Or Certifications
  • State of

    Work Location:

    Illinois
    Basic Life Support Health Care Provider (BLS HCP) - American Heart Association (AHA)
    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) - National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C)
    Respiratory Care Practitioner, Registered -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ation (IDFPR)
  • State of

    Work Location:

    Missouri
    Basic Life Support Health Care Provider (BLS HCP) - American Heart Association (AHA)
    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) - National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C)
    Respiratory Care Practitioner - Missouri Division of Professional Registration
    Or Respiratory Educ Permit - Missouri Division of Professional Registration
  • State of

    Work Location:

    Oklahoma
    Basic Life Support Health Care Provider (BLS HCP) - American Heart Association (AHA)
    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) - National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C)
    Letter of Acknowledgement of Receipt of Application for Respiratory Care Practitioner.

    - Oklahoma Medical Board
    Or Provisional Respiratory Care Therapist - Oklahoma Medical Board
    Or Respiratory Care Practitioner - Oklahoma Medical Board
  • State of

    Work Location:

    Wisconsin
    Basic Life Support Health Care Provider (BLS HCP) - American Heart Association (AHA)
    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) - National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C)
    Respiratory Care Practitioner - Wisconsin Department of Safety and Professional Services
